Jacqueline Mora
Jacqueline Mora is the Technical Deputy Minister of Tourism for the Dominican Republic, recognized for her strategic role in enhancing the country's tourism sector. In a recent interview, she emphasized the importance of diversifying tourist experiences beyond traditional sun and beach offerings, showcasing cultural, culinary, and adventure tourism to attract a growing number of Colombian visitors. Mora is actively involved in promoting new tourist destinations and ensuring sustainable practices within the industry, as well as advocating for improved standards in short-term rental accommodations.
